TLDRThis video introduces different types of three-dimensional shapes (solid figures) and their characteristics. It starts with the cube, explaining its properties such as six congruent square faces, 12 equal edges, and eight vertices. Next, it covers the rectangular prism (cuboid) and its features, followed by the square pyramid and triangular prism. The video also discusses the properties of cylinders and cones, commonly found in everyday objects. Each shape is illustrated with practical examples, and their key attributes are explained clearly. The video aims to educate viewers about the essential properties of these geometric shapes.

Takeaways

  • 📩 The first 3D shape discussed is the cube, defined by six congruent square faces, with examples such as dice and Rubik's cubes.
  • đŸ§± A cube has six equal faces, twelve equal edges, and eight vertices, which are named by letters at each corner.
  • 📏 The cube has 12 diagonal edges, which are the diagonals of its square faces, and it also has four space diagonals connecting opposite corners.
  • 📐 The second 3D shape discussed is the rectangular prism (or cuboid), formed by six rectangular faces, with real-world examples like a box or a TV.
  • đŸ”Č A rectangular prism has three sets of four edges, where each set consists of equal-length edges for its width, length, and height.
  • đŸ”ș The next shape is the square pyramid, which has a square base and triangular sides meeting at a single point, like the Egyptian pyramids.
  • đŸ”» The square pyramid has five faces, eight edges, and five vertices, and the diagonals exist on the square base.
  • đŸŽȘ The triangular pyramid is introduced, with a triangular base and faces that are also triangles, similar to a tent structure.
  • 🏠 The triangular prism is made of two triangular faces and three rectangular faces, resembling the shape of a house roof.
  • âšȘ The cylinder, consisting of two circular faces and a curved surface, is described with examples like cans and pipes.

Q & A

  • What is the definition of a cube according to the script?

    -A cube is a three-dimensional shape that is bounded by six congruent square faces.

  • What are some examples of cube-shaped objects mentioned in the video?

    -Examples include a die, a Rubik's cube, and a gift box.

  • How many edges does a cube have, and what are they called?

    -A cube has 12 edges. These edges are named AB, BC, CD, DA, EF, FG, GH, HE, AE, BF, CG, and DH.

  • What is a rectangular prism and how is it described in the video?

    -A rectangular prism is a three-dimensional shape formed by three pairs of rectangles, with at least one pair having different dimensions.

  • What are the characteristics of a rectangular prism?

    -A rectangular prism has six faces, twelve edges, and eight vertices. Its faces are arranged in three pairs of rectangles.

  • How are the diagonals of a cube categorized?

    -A cube has 12 face diagonals and 4 space diagonals.

  • What is the difference between a cube and a rectangular prism in terms of their edges?

    -A cube has 12 edges of equal length, while a rectangular prism has 12 edges divided into three sets of four edges, each with different lengths (long, wide, and tall edges).

  • What is the definition of a square pyramid (limas segiempat) in the video?

    -A square pyramid is a three-dimensional shape consisting of a square base and triangular faces that meet at a single vertex.

  • What are the properties of a square pyramid described in the video?

    -A square pyramid has five faces (one square and four triangular), eight edges, and five vertices.

  • What are the characteristics of a cylinder according to the script?

    -A cylinder has three faces: two circular bases and one curved surface. It also has two circular edges.
